Bückmann Expands in Mönchengladbach with New Production Hub

Bückmann GmbH & Co. KG has inaugurated a 2,500-square-metre facility in Mönchengladbach, centralizing its screening and fabric operations to boost efficiency and meet rising demand in the food, chemical, and hygiene sectors.
Bückmann GmbH & Co. KG has moved into new, modern production facilities right next to its headquarters in Mönchengladbach. The previous halls could now be reunited on an area of more than 2,500 square metres. This enables Bückmann to create the ideal conditions for efficient processes and the highest quality standards.

Strategic Expansion and Site Consolidation

The production facilities previously used at the headquarters will be taken over by the sister company, Bückmann Lohnaufbereitung GmbH & Co. KG. The well-known bulk material toller requires these in order expand its capacities for growing needs in screening, mixing, grinding, compacting and filling on a contract basis.

Precision Manufacturing for Custom Fabric Solutions

On the other hand, the new production facilities will be used for tensioning screen frames and assemble state-of-the-art plastic and metal fabrics. Various manufacturing methods enable flexible and precise processing – from individual custom-made products starting at one piece to larger series.

Versatile Engineering for Diverse Industrial Needs

The new halls have been designed to meet the market requirements of the food, animal feed and hygiene industries. Of course, industries such as stone/earth/minerals, wood and plastics, as well as chemicals, can also be served optimally. This wide industry focus enables Bückmann to respond to a large range of needs and offer customer-specific solutions.

Advanced Bonding and Fabrication Techniques

The range of services includes the tensioning of new and used screen frames using various fixing techniques, from tailored adhesive technology to soldering and welding processes. In addition, Bückmann offers the manufacturing of plastic fabrics using methods such as sewing, gluing and high-frequency welding. Metal fabrics are also processed individually according to customer requirements. With this focus, Bückmann covers a wide range of requirements relating to screen technology and fabric processing.

A Commitment to Local Talent and Sustainability

Around 20 employees work at the new production site, including several newly hired specialists who specifically strengthen the team. In addition to state-of-the-art production technology, the company attaches great importance to sustainability. The new halls have an environmentally friendly energy supply that supports sustainable and resource-saving use.
